Easy Soft Batch Pumpkin Chocolate Chip Cookies No Chill

These soft batch pumpkin chocolate chip cookies are incredibly pillowy and tender, with no chill time required. Made with simple pantry ingredients, they come together in under 30 minutes for a cozy fall treat.

Ingredients

  • 1 ¾ cups (220g) all-purpose flour
  • ½ teaspoon baking soda
  • 1 teaspoon baking powder
  • 1 teaspoon pumpkin pie spice
  • ½ teaspoon ground cinnamon
  • ½ teaspoon salt
  • 1 tablespoon cornstarch
  • ½ cup (115g) unsalted butter, melted
  • ¾ cup (150g) packed light brown sugar
  • ¼ cup (50g) granulated sugar
  • 1 large egg + 1 egg yolk
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• ½ cup (120g) pumpkin puree
  • 1 ½ cups (260g) semi-sweet chocolate chips

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C). Line two baking sheets with parchment paper or silicone baking mats.
  2. In a medium bowl, whisk together flour, baking soda, baking powder, pumpkin pie spice, cinnamon, salt, and cornstarch.
  3. In a large bowl, whisk together melted butter, brown sugar, and granulated sugar until smooth. Add egg, egg yolk, and vanilla extract; whisk vigorously for about 30 seconds until pale and slightly thickened.
  4. Add pumpkin puree and whisk until fully incorporated (batter may look curdled).
  5. Add dry ingredients to wet mixture; fold with a rubber spatula just until no streaks of flour remain. Dough will be soft and sticky.
  6. Fold in chocolate chips until evenly distributed. Reserve a handful to press onto dough balls if desired.
  7. Using a 1.5-tablespoon cookie scoop or two spoons, portion dough into 1.5-inch balls. Place on prepared baking sheets, spacing 2 inches apart. Press extra chocolate chips onto tops if desired.
  8. Bake for 10-12 minutes, until edges are set and tops look puffed and matte (centers will still look soft).
  9. Let cookies cool on baking sheet for 5 minutes, then transfer to a wire rack to cool completely.
  10. Serve warm or at room temperature.

Notes

Don’t overmix the dough to avoid tough cookies. Use room temperature eggs. Measure flour correctly by spooning and leveling. For softer cookies, bake for 10 minutes; for firmer, bake for 12. Let cookies cool on the pan for 5 minutes before transferring.
